Using Pivot Tables in Google Sheets is slightly more limited than Excel, simply because you cannot set them up through Android or iOS — it must be done via a web browser on a computer.

In Excel 2010, there is a subtle way to hook all four pivot tables up to the same set of slicers. Thus, the VP of Sales selects from the slicers and all four pivot tables update at once.
